Several factors are accelerating the growth of the cryogenic liquid railway tank car market. Firstly, the burgeoning demand for liquefied natural gas (LNG) and other cryogenic fuels is a major driver. The global shift towards cleaner energy sources is fueling the need for efficient LNG transportation infrastructure, boosting the demand for specialized railway tank cars. Secondly, the expanding healthcare sector relies heavily on cryogenic transportation for pharmaceuticals, vaccines, and other temperature-sensitive products. This necessitates a reliable and efficient transportation system, further boosting the market's growth. Thirdly, advancements in cryogenic tank car technology, including improved insulation and safety features, are enhancing the efficiency and safety of transportation, increasing their adoption across various industries. The development of lighter yet stronger materials is reducing operating costs and improving fuel efficiency. Finally, favorable government regulations and policies aimed at improving transportation infrastructure and promoting the use of cleaner energy sources are creating a conducive environment for market expansion. These combined forces ensure sustained and robust growth in the cryogenic liquid railway tank car market in the coming years.
Despite the promising growth outlook, the cryogenic liquid railway tank car market faces several challenges. High initial investment costs associated with manufacturing and maintaining these specialized tank cars can deter smaller players and limit market accessibility. Strict safety regulations and compliance requirements necessitate rigorous quality control and maintenance, adding to operational costs. The inherent risks associated with transporting cryogenic liquids pose significant safety concerns, requiring robust safety protocols and trained personnel to mitigate accidents. Fluctuations in the prices of raw materials used in manufacturing, such as steel and specialized insulation materials, can affect production costs and market stability. Furthermore, infrastructure limitations, such as the lack of adequate rail networks or specialized loading and unloading facilities in certain regions, can hinder market expansion. Finally, competition from alternative transportation modes, such as road tankers and pipelines, presents a considerable challenge. Addressing these challenges effectively will be critical for sustained market growth.
